Why Full Removal Matters
A lot of homeowners start by asking the same question: “Can we just fill in our old pool?” And in some cases, partial removal and fill-in can seem like the easiest route.
But the truth is, filling in a pool doesn’t always solve the problem. It can leave behind buried structure, uneven settling, drainage issues, or areas of the yard that never feel quite stable. Over time, that can limit what you can do with the space and create headaches if you ever plan to landscape, build, or sell your home.
That’s why we approach demolition with the long view in mind. Full pool removal gives you a clean slate and helps ensure your backyard can be safely used, improved, and enjoyed for years to come.
What To Expect During Pool Removal
Pool demolition can feel like a big unknown, especially if you’ve never been through a project like this. Our job is to make it clear, organized, and handled the right way from start to finish.
While every property is different, most pool removal projects follow a similar path:
01
Site evaluation & plan
We’ll assess your existing pool, access points, and the surrounding yard so we can recommend the right demolition approach and set expectations upfront.
02
Demolition & removal
Our team removes the pool structure safely and efficiently, keeping the jobsite clean and minimizing disruption as much as possible.
03
Backfill, grading & stabilization
We backfill the area properly, compacting in lifts and grading the yard so the space is stable and usable, not just “covered up.”
04
Final walkthrough & next steps
Once the pool is removed, we’ll walk the site with you and talk through what comes next, whether that’s sod, turf, landscaping, fencing, or outdoor living upgrades.
